Please be advised that effective immediately, 9th/10th Avenue under the Highway 23 bridge, near downtown, is closed due to predicted flooding. Road closures and an alternative hospital route are clearly marked. All traffic should avoid this area. Vehicles should not attempt to use the road when flooded.
Flooding on 9th/10th Avenue under the Hwy 23 Bridge occurred during the recent storms on Monday, May 9th and Wednesday, May 11th. Strong storms are predicted once again for today, May 12th. This area is prone to flash flooding due primarily to elevations and the large storm shed that flows to this area. When possible, the City will be closing this roadway preemptively to prevent vehicles from stalling or being carried away.
Six inches of water will reach the bottom of most passenger cars, causing loss of control and possible stalling. A foot of water will float many vehicles. Two feet of rushing water can carry away most vehicles, including sport utility vehicles and pick-ups.
